The role of SFP single-mode optical modules

Single-mode SFP optical modules convert electrical signals into optical signals for long-distance, high-speed data transmission over single-mode fiber.

Core Functions

Signal Conversion: Single-mode SFP modules act as transceivers, converting electrical signals from network devices into optical signals for transmission over single-mode fiber, and vice versa for received signals, enabling seamless communication between switches, routers, and servers . Long-Distance Transmission: These modules are optimized for single-mode fiber with a small core (approximately 9/125 µm), supporting long-distance links ranging from 2 km up to 120 km depending on the module type and optical power budget . They operate at wavelengths typically of 1310 nm or 1550 nm, which minimizes signal loss and dispersion over extended distances . Hot-Swappable Flexibility: Single-mode SFPs are hot-pluggable, allowing network engineers to insert or replace modules without powering down devices, which enhances network scalability and maintenance efficiency . High Bandwidth and Stability: By using laser-based transmission, single-mode SFPs provide high bandwidth and stable signal quality, making them suitable for backbone, metro, and wide-area network applications .

Types and Specialized Functions

  • 1000BASE-LX: Standard long-distance Gigabit Ethernet transmission, typically up to 10 km .
  • 1000BASE-EX: Extended reach beyond standard LX modules, suitable for distances over 10 km .
  • 1000BASE-ZX: Long-haul applications, often exceeding 70 km, requiring higher optical power .
  • BiDi (Bidirectional): Transmits and receives data over a single fiber strand using two wavelengths, ideal for fiber-limited environments .
  • CWDM/DWDM SFPs: Enable multiple optical signals over the same fiber using different wavelengths, increasing fiber capacity for high-density networks .

Advantages

  • Extended Reach: Supports long-distance communication with minimal signal attenuation .
  • High Compatibility: Works with a wide range of network equipment due to standardized form factors and Multi-Source Agreement (MSA) compliance .
  • Low Power Consumption: Efficient operation suitable for large-scale deployments .
  • Enhanced Network Design: Facilitates scalable, high-performance networks across enterprise, data center, and telecom environments . In summary, single-mode SFP optical modules are essential for converting electrical signals to optical signals for long-distance, high-speed, and reliable data transmission, offering flexibility, scalability, and compatibility for modern fiber optic networks .
